One third of the amino acid residues is glycine, and the glycyl residues are evenly spaced: (Gly X Y)n, where X and Y are other amino acids is the amino acid sequence of collagen. NADH has a hydrogen attached to one nitrogen-containing ring, whereas in NAD+ this same ring lacks a hydrogen and has a positive charge.
